Buying Guide
When selecting a pull-behind cart for a riding lawn mower, consider these factors to ensure optimal performance and lasting value:
- Load capacity and bed size: Match the trailer’s payload to the heaviest loads you typically haul. Higher capacity reduces trips but may add weight during transport.
- Material and build quality: Steel frames offer durability for heavy debris and soil; aluminum options are lighter but may have lower weight limits.
- Hitch compatibility: Verify that the cart’s hitch matches your mower, tractor, or UTV. Universal or adjustable hitch systems improve versatility.
- Dump mechanism and ease of unloading: Quick-release or hand-dump designs save time, especially on large-volume tasks.
- Wheels and suspension: All-terrain tires provide stability on grass and gravel. Larger wheel diameter often improves clearance and rolling comfort.
- Removable sides and railings: Removability adds flexibility for oversized or irregular loads.
- Ease of assembly and maintenance: Look for straightforward setup, available replacement parts, and simple maintenance requirements.
- Storage and maneuverability: Consider overall trailer dimensions for garage or shed storage and how easy it is to maneuver in tight spaces.
In comparing these options, evaluate how often you’ll need maximum capacity versus everyday hauling, the terrain you traverse, and how frequently you will unload heavy loads. The best choice balances load capacity, durability, ease of use, and compatibility with your riding mower or tractor.
